Re: [qmailtoaster] rblsmtpd

2010-01-03 Thread Jake Vickers

On 01/01/2010 07:31 PM, qmtl...@parsonsphotography.com wrote:


A quick question about rblsmtpd. I added 2 more urls to the blacklist 
file but it still only seems to check the first in the list. I tried 
qmailctl stop / start with no success. Is the program designed to run 
this way by default or do I have to rebuild the tcp.smtp or qmailctl cdb?


Here is what my blacklists file looks like:

-r zen.spamhaus.org -r list.dsbl.org -r combined.njabl.org



Why do you think it only runs the first?
If it *matches* the first, it does not check the rest, otherwise you'll 
need to show us data showing that it is not using the rest.

Re: [qmailtoaster] Squirremail in Portuguese

2010-01-03 Thread Aleksander Podsiadły
W dniu 03.01.2010 07:20, Anderson Alves de Albuquerque pisze:


  I am with Qmail-Toaster in my server CentOS 5.X, I need to change
 language to Portuguese. How can I change English (default) to Portuguese?
Starting from site http://squirrelmail.org/download.php find proper
language file, probably:
http://sourceforge.net/projects/squirrelmail/files/locales/1.4.18-20090526/pt_PT-1.4.18-20090526.tar.gz/download

After installing locale and help files change the default language:
cd /usr/share/squirrelmail/config
./conf.pl

Re: [qmailtoaster] SpamAssassin Y2K10 bug

2010-01-03 Thread Jake Vickers

Eric Shubert wrote:

This was posted this afternoon on the vpopmail list:

Tom Collins wrote:
If you're running SpamAssassin, be aware that it has a rule that's 
adding points to all mail with a 2010 date.


You can fix it by adding the following to your local.cf and 
restarting spamassassin.


scoreFH_DATE_PAST_20XX0.0

See https://issues.apache.org/SpamAssassin/show_bug.cgi?id=6269 for 
details.


-Tom


Can we perhaps come up with a better fix?

In the meantime, I'd suggest making this change, then running
# qmail-spam restart



Thanks for posting that Eric. I didn't see the announcement until today 
- I actually saw your post first.
Anyway, as an FYI, updating your rules via sa-update should resolve this 
(can anyone confirm?):


Subject: Apache SpamAssassin Y2K10 Rule Bug - Update Your Rules Now!
From: Daryl C. W. O'Shea spamassas...@dostech.ca
Date: Sat, 02 Jan 2010 02:38:13 -0500

I've posted the following note on the Apache SpamAssassin website [1]
about an issue with a rule that may cause wanted email to be classified
as spam by SpamAssassin.  If you're running SpamAssassin 3.2.x you are
encouraged to update you rules (updates were released on sa-update
around 1900 UTC Jan 1, 2010).

Y2K10 Rule Bug - Update Your Rules Now!

RE: [qmailtoaster] SpamAssassin Y2K10 bug

2010-01-03 Thread Tim Pleiman
The offending rule:

FH_DATE_PAST_20XX

is in:

/usr/share/spamassassin/72_active.cf

and is scored by:

/usr/share/spamassassin/50_scores.cf

I would just remove the the rules and scores in these files, in addition
to modifying your local.cf file to prevent future incarnations.

There is some bit of controversy as to the rule existing at all and the
fact that even though it was supposedly corrected 5 months ago, it was not
pushed out to the installations or most update processes.

Based on the fact that it wasn't killed ages ago, who knows whether or not
it'll slip back in again?

Tim

[qmailtoaster] The Brilliant SA Y210K bugfix...NOT!

2010-01-03 Thread Tim Pleiman
This is the fix that was pushed out...

From this:

##{ FH_DATE_PAST_20XX
header   FH_DATE_PAST_20XX  Date =~ /20[1-9][0-9]/ [if-unset: 2006]
describe FH_DATE_PAST_20XX  The date is grossly in the future.
##} FH_DATE_PAST_20XX

To this:

##{ FH_DATE_PAST_20XX
header   FH_DATE_PAST_20XX  Date =~ /20[2-9][0-9]/ [if-unset: 2006]
describe FH_DATE_PAST_20XX  The date is grossly in the future.
##} FH_DATE_PAST_20XX

It's a very badly written rule.

Tim
